Presenting this exceptional four-bedroom detached family home located in the heart of Old Catton, just North of Norwich, situated opposite an attractive park, this property offers lovely views and a peaceful setting.Step into the entrance hall with cloakroom, then leading to an impressive 18`8` double aspect lounge with a bay window and a similarly spacious kitchen/ breakfast room, perfect for family gatherings and entertaining. Adjacent to the kitchen is a wonderful garden room with bi-fold doors to the garden providing a tranquil retreat to enjoy the beautiful surroundings. Upstairs, you will find four well proportioned bedrooms, and an en-suite to the main bedroom, all accessed from the landing. The property benefits from gas central heating and double glazing, ensuring comfort and energy efficiency. Outside, a driveway provides off road parking for up to five cars, along with a brick-built single garage. The rear garden is a true delight, featuring a patio area, lawns, ornamental pond, and a garden shed/workshop, ideal for outdoor living and gardening enthusiasts. This immaculately presented family home offers both comfort and style, coupled with a convenient location and stunning views. Canopy entrance porch
Double glazed front entrance door to:-

Entrance Hall
Staircase to the first floor,, doors to the lounge, kitchen/breakfast room and cloakroom.

Cloakroom
Double glazed window to the rear, low level WC, wash basin, half tiled walls.

Lounge - 18'8" (5.69m) x 11'4" (3.45m)
Double glazed window to the front, double glazed bay window to the side, spotlights, feature electric fireplace.

Kitchen/Breakfast Room - 18'11" (5.77m) x 11'4" (3.45m)
Double glazed window to the front, double glazed window to the side, part double glazed door to the rear, spotlights, fitted with a quality range of base and wall units, solid Beech wood work surfaces, insert one and a half bowl stainless steel sink and drainer with mixer taps over tiled splashback, inset five ring stainless steel gas hob, integrated electric oven and grill, integrated microwave, integrated dishwasher, space for a washing machine, space for an American style fridge/freezer, French doors to:-


Garden Room - 16'10" (5.13m) x 10'8" (3.25m)
Double glazed bi-fold doors to the rear garden, roof lantern, spotlights, wall mounted air conditioning unit.

First Floor Landing
Double glazed window to the rear, airing cupboard, doors to all rooms.

Bedroom 1 - 11'9" (3.58m) x 9'1" (2.77m) Plus Recess
Double glazed windows to the front and side, door to:-



En-Suite Shower Room
Double glazed window to the front, double shower cubicle, low level WC, wash basin set into vanity unit, spotlights, extractor fan, chrome heated towel radiator.

Bedroom 2 - 11'6" (3.51m) x 8'7" (2.62m)
Double glazed window to the side.

Bedroom 3 - 10'3" (3.12m) x 8'5" (2.57m)
Double glazed windows to the front and side.



Bedroom 4 - 8'8" (2.64m) x 6'9" (2.06m)
Double glazed window to the rear.

Bathroom
Double glazed window to the front, bath with electric Mira shower over, wash basin set into vanity unit, low level WC, tiled splashbacks, inset spotlights.

Outside
To the front there is a cobblestone central pathway to the front door with lawns to either side, enclosed by laurel hedging, brickweave driveway providing off road parking for up to 5 cars, timber gates give access to a further driveway to the rear which intern gives access to the detached brick built garage with roller door, power, light and double glazed personnel door to the rear garden. The rear garden is laid to lawn with a patio area, ornamental raised pond, timber garden shed/workshop, outside lighting, outside water point and outside power points, all enclosed by timber fencing.
